WebSep 1, 2014 · “inalienable” and “unalienable” are both correct and mean the same thing (even the drafters of the Declaration of Independence went back and forth on that one), as do “inadvisable” and “unadvisable.” Still, the two prefixes are not equivalent. As a pretty flimsy general rule, UN – goes with Germanic roots and IN – goes with Latin roots,
